Author: Catherine Ryan Hyde
Seth and his little brother Henry haven't had the most stable of upbringings. Their father has been in and out of jail; their mother took off years ago and hasn't been seen since. Life is constantly uncertain, but a twist of fate could be just what they need. August stopped drinking the day his son died. While o...  more »

This is the first book in quite awhile which I didn't want to put down and looked forward to picking up. Ryan Hyde likes stories with inter-generational relationships. We live in a society where most everything is age segregated, unfortunately both generations miss out. As a former public school teacher, I think that she picked the perfect main character in August. A teacher must love children/young people and believe in their future possibilities. The two brothers were believable and actions age appropriate. I wanted to take them home with me. I have read a few of this author's books and thought that Pay it Forward was one of her weaker stories, so if you are undecided, give another one of her books a try. Her books delve into serious issues and situations, but she writes about second chances and being aware of the people who you encounter, and the possibility that you can be a positive moment in their lives.

This is my second Catherine Ryan Hyde book and I have loved them both. This is the story of a man named August, who is dealing with the loss of his 19 year old son, and two young boys he is coerced to travel with in his motorhome for the summer while visiting several National Parks. I loved watching the relationship grow between the boys and August and how they were able to slowly help each other deal with various difficulties in their lives. The characters are well developed and the descriptions of the various National Parks they visited were outstanding. It moved me to look up several of the locations mentioned in the book.
